Overton Colliery [Pit]

Overton Steadings, Blairhall, Fife.

NGR:NT 00080 89700
WGS84:56.08961, -3.60744
Length:Not recorded
Vert. Range:Not recorded
Altitude:88 m
Geology:Overton Gas Coal
Tags:Mine, Shaft, ManMade, Archaeo, Lost, CoalMine
Registry:second

Mine (Coal), mid-19th cent.

Small-scale workings in the Overton Gas Coal at 30 fathoms [55m], measuring ca. 140m from SW to NE. Mine plan shows B9037 road passing over the centre of the worked area that was surveyed in January 1867 (post-1st ed. OS map). Shaft now buried below field on W edge of Blairhall.
